Part 1 | Plant the SeedStop Waiting for the Perfect Moment 🌱

Here's what most of us do with a dream: we hold it. We protect it. We think about it at 2am and then tuck it safely away again because bringing it out into the open feels risky. What if it doesn't happen? What if people think I'm foolish?

But real faith doesn't get planted by sitting on the shelf. It gets planted by bringing that dream to God — out loud, on your knees, in the car, wherever — and saying, "Lord, here it is. What do You think?" That conversation with God? That's the soil. Then you take it to the Word. You find scriptures that speak life over that specific dream. You write them down. You put them somewhere you can see them. That's how you create the right environment for faith to take root and come alive.

The seed doesn't bloom on the shelf. It blooms in the soil. So bring it out. Bring it to God. And plant it.

Part 2 | Water It The Daily Practice That Makes Faith Real 💧

I used to think faith was something you mustered up in a big moment — some heroic act of believing hard enough and God would respond. What I've learned, both in my garden and in my walk with God, is that faith is far more like a daily habit than a heroic moment.

You don't water a seedling once and call it done. You come back every day, even on the days it doesn't look like anything is happening. You speak God's Word over that dream — out loud, with intention — and you thank Him for what He is already doing, even before you can see it. This is the practice. And it's in this daily, quiet, unglamorous watering that the most extraordinary things begin to shift. You'll notice a change in your posture, your peace, your expectation. The thing starts to feel less like a wish and more like a certainty.

Water daily. Don't skip the practice just because you can't see the results yet. The roots are growing underneath.

Part 3 | Tend the GrowthCelebrate and Let Go 🪴

One of my favourite parts of gardening has become what I call the art of noticing. When that first tiny leaf pushed up through the soil, I was so genuinely happy. And I think God loves it when we notice His handiwork and say, "There You are, Lord. I see You." Celebrating the small signs of breakthrough in your faith journey isn't naive optimism — it's an act of worship.

But there's another layer too. Mature gardeners practice deadheading — removing the spent blooms so that the plant can send its energy to new growth. And so it is in our faith. There are things — habits, thought patterns, maybe even relationships or commitments — that are drawing energy away from where God wants to take you next. Ask Him honestly what needs to go. Be willing to let it go. The space you create by removing what's dead is exactly where the most beautiful new growth will come.

Tend the garden, friend. Notice the growth. Release the dead things. And watch what God does next.
